**Q: How do we vendor third-party fonts into the Quillmark build?**

A: Copy the licensed font files into `vendor/fonts`, update the manifest, and run the checksum script. Don't pull fonts at build time; the Quillmark pipeline is offline by design. Licenses go in `vendor/licenses`, one file per family. The vendored bundle is encrypted at rest because some licenses restrict redistribution. To decrypt it locally, the tooling will prompt for the passphrase given below.

unlock words, hahip-baduf: holwyn-istath-julvan

**Runbook: Consent banner rollout (Larkspur web)**

Quick notes before you approve the flag flip: the banner ships dark to the Tolbrook region first, then everywhere after 24h of clean metrics. Check that dismissal state persists across the session-storage fallback — that bit us last quarter. If the error budget dips, kill the flag and ping on-call. The rollout was verified against build:

session token of tajef-bageg = htk21_5d90d574934f3ccae6437

**Q: How do team assistants arrange access to the Prototype Workshop on Level B2?**

The Fennick Labs workshop houses active milling and laser equipment, so access is restricted at all times. Assistants booking sessions for their teams must confirm that attendees have completed the workshop safety briefing with the Ardenvale Facilities team at least two business days in advance. Once the briefing is logged, use the code below at the inner door keypad.

badge for fafop-fajof: bdg-Z-47

- [ ] Step 7: Archive cold storage buckets (Glacierline tier). Confirm both ceremony witnesses are present, verify bucket manifests match the Oxbow ledger, then seal the archive key shares. Plugin authors may observe but not handle shares. Once sealed, the archive index itself is encrypted and can only be reopened with the passphrase below.

vault phrase of badup-hahig = tamael-aldael-kelmir-istael-fenok-istwyn-tamius-jorath-oliion

Step 3: Update your plugin manifest for DocSift 4.x. The old `lint.rules` key is gone; rules now register through the `checks` array. Remove any `legacy_mode` flags — the linter rejects them outright. Rebuild against the 4.x SDK before publishing. Once your manifest validates, point the plugin at a local DocSift instance configured with the following values.

deployment values, kagaf-kahag:
[prawyn]
port = 6379
region = east-2
host = prawyn.qirvanlabs.corp
timeout_ms = 750
retries = 1